The nanomaterials play a vital role in improving the efficiency of cooling systems due to enhanced thermal features. In countries like Pakistan, where energy crisesand inefficient thermal management are major challenges, nanofluids provide a solution to reduce energy losses. The main goal of this study is to analyze optimizedheat transfer effects with applications of modern Artificial Neural Networks (ANN) with more effective thermal performances and applications in advancedengineering and energy systems. The results show that implementing ANN is more effective in boosting the thermal behavior of hybrid nanomaterials with moreefficient thermal performances.
